La Api de Facebook antigua, en la que está basada la mayor parte de este post, está siendo reemplazada poco a poco por una nueva api de facebook. Es necesario que sepas que Facebook cada día da menos soporte a su antigua api y a Facebook Connect.
Si estás buscando información general sobre este tema te recomiendo que leas los artículos más actuales en la categoría Facebook Graph Api de este mismo blog.
Más concretamente, y en relación a este artículo, puedes leer:
Uno de los grandes añadidos que diferencia a la red social de FaceBook es la posibilidad de crear aplicaciones mediante una API propia. Con ella cualquier programador web puede crear su aplicación para que los distintos usuarios de la red social por excelencia se la «instalen» en sus perfiles.
La cara más conocida de estas aplicaciones son los odiosos tests que llenan de spam la página de inicio de cualquier cuenta. Las primeras aplicaciones de la API realmente se crearon para que los usuarios contasen con un juguete más que usar dentro de la red. Pero las posibilidades de la API no se quedan sólo como simples añadidos y hoy en día es posible controlar mediante aplicaciones de FaceBook gran cantidad de las opciones que tienen los propios usuarios en la red mediante aplicaciones externas.
En este post voy a dejar unos pocos links para iniciarse con el tema. No van a solucionarte todos tus problemas pero son un punto de partida con el que empezar a hacer nuestros pinitos en las aplicaciones para FaceBook.
- Página de desarrolladores de Facebook»: Con un par de tutoriales y todas las indicaciones necesarias para ponerse en marcha.
- Primer Tutorial Está lo suficientemente bien hecho como para que empieces a poner tu aplicación en marcha en pocos minutos
- Aplicación para Desarrolladores: Indispensable para montar tus propias aplicaciones. Te permite configurarlas y conocer tu ApiKey
- Descarga la Librería PHP para interactuar con la API
- Referencia de la API Con la que podemos ver todas las llamadas que podemos realizar para pedir o mandar información a FaceBook
- Referencia del lenguaje de marcado de FaceBook Con la que podemos ver como mostrar los nombres de usaurio, sus fotos o sus datos personales en nuestras aplicaciones
- Herramientas de Desarrollo Herramientas online para probar las aplicaciones
Por ejemplo, nosotros en nuestra
3 respuestas a “API de Facebook : Crear una aplicación para FaceBook”
Hola, sabes como se puede vincular imagenes de los usuarios de facebook en las aplicaciones?? es que debo de jalar de facebook las imagenes de los usuarios en mi aplicación, hasta el momento solo hace lo que esta destinado, lo cual es imprimir sobre una imagen otra (así como marca de agua), lo que necesito es ver como lo publico en facebook, para ser más presisos necesito que esa imagen resultante generada se guarde en algún album del usuario que use la aplicación.
Ya solicite los permisos necesarios, pero nose como ahcer para que ellos selecciones sus imagenes y la pasen por la aplicación.
Gracias de antemano
saludos
Hola Iñaki, estaba siguiendo tu post y he logrado a hacer una aplicacion de estas,al final resulta que me pedia esto ,que tiene que aceptar,osea decir que SI : My website provides a personalized landing page from App Center.
Mi web ¿ como va a tener una landing page ? pero una landing page no es algo que se hace solo dentro del perfil del facebook ? Como va a tener mi web de apartamentos una landing page ? no lo entiendo. Un saludo
Cuando entras en una app de facebook puedes hacer que en un iframe se muestre una pagina tuya. Asi se ve el Layot de facebook pero todo el centro de la app en realidad es tu web.
Si no me equivoco esa es la página de landing que te piden.